Freight Operations Begin at Heelalige Goods Shed, Boosting Bengaluru-Hosur Rail Route
ADVERTISEMENT

Freight operations have officially commenced at the newly inaugurated Heelalige Goods Shed, a pivotal development aimed at enhancing rail freight connectivity between Bengaluru and Hosur. This milestone is expected to significantly improve logistics efficiency and reduce the reliance on road transport for cargo movement in the region.


Key Features of the Heelalige Goods Shed

  1. Strategic Location:
    • Situated on the Bengaluru-Hosur rail corridor, the goods shed is ideally positioned to serve industrial hubs in Karnataka and Tamil Nadu.
    • Its proximity to Bengaluru’s major industrial zones ensures seamless cargo handling and faster transportation.
  2. Advanced Infrastructure:
    • The facility is equipped with state-of-the-art loading and unloading systems, minimizing turnaround times.
    • Warehousing spaces and storage yards provide ample capacity for diverse types of cargo, including industrial goods, agricultural produce, and consumer products.
  3. Sustainability Focus:
    • Rail freight is inherently more eco-friendly than road transport, reducing carbon emissions and easing traffic congestion on highways.

Benefits for the Bengaluru-Hosur Region

  1. Improved Connectivity:
    • The goods shed enhances the Bengaluru-Hosur rail corridor, facilitating smoother freight movement and connecting industries to national and international markets.
  2. Cost Efficiency:
    • Businesses can save on logistics costs by leveraging rail transport, which is more economical for bulk shipments compared to road transport.
  3. Boost to Regional Trade:
    • The facility supports industries in the region, including manufacturing, textiles, and agriculture, by providing efficient logistics solutions.
  4. Job Creation:
    • The new operations are expected to generate employment opportunities in logistics, transportation, and warehousing.

Impact on the Rail Freight Sector

  1. Shift from Road to Rail:
    • The Heelalige Goods Shed is part of a broader initiative to increase the share of rail in freight transport, reducing the strain on road infrastructure.
  2. Enhanced Supply Chain Resilience:
    • Improved rail infrastructure ensures reliable and timely delivery, mitigating disruptions caused by road congestion or fuel price volatility.
  3. Support for Sustainable Logistics:
    • Encouraging rail freight aligns with India’s sustainability goals, contributing to lower environmental impact and energy consumption.

Challenges and Opportunities

  • Challenges:
    • Ensuring adequate rail capacity to handle the expected increase in freight volumes.
    • Addressing last-mile connectivity issues for industries located away from rail lines.
  • Opportunities:
    • Expanding the use of multimodal transport solutions by integrating rail, road, and air logistics.
    • Attracting more industries to adopt rail freight, boosting regional economic development.

Looking Ahead

The launch of freight operations at the Heelalige Goods Shed marks a significant step in strengthening India’s rail freight network and promoting sustainable logistics. As industries increasingly leverage this facility, the Bengaluru-Hosur corridor is poised to become a critical link in the nation’s supply chain infrastructure.
